The fan motor just went out on my 12 year old American Standard, 15.25 SEER/13 EER Heatpump. Replacing just the fan motor, parts and labor, will be $934. Replacing the entire unit with an American Standard, 16 SEER/13EER Heatpump, parts and labor, will be $6,850 after a $500 energy rebate.

The unit has been trouble-free for 12 years and has always had yearly preventive maintenance. Texas summers can be brutal and with a 12 year old unit, I'm not sure if spending almost $1K on one replacement part is the best option. I agree with the above. I'd also add opportunity cost to the calculation. ($6850 - $934) * 4% another ~ $236/year. So every added year it runs 'saves' another $236/year (on average). $571 + $236 = $707, so you could be ahead in just over a year.

Maybe factor in a new unit will save some energy, offsetting that some (but 15.25 vs 16 doesn't sound like much, you'd need to do that math)?

And another quote. $934 seems high for a standard, non-variable speed fan replacement.

I'm on my 3rd interior fan motor. The original fan died under it warranty, I got it replaced. When the replacement motor developed a noisy be"aring, I ordered a bearing and then my brother-in-law, an HVAC guy said, no, I have replaced to many ECM type motors, I'll put in a PSC motor". So he did and it has worked fine for the last several years.
I'll never know if the new bearing would have done just as well. But I do know the ECM type motor has many electronic components to go bad. Note: they are encased in a potting compound to prevent you from replacing a $4 part and instead, having to buy a $300 motor.
The PSC type motor is all wire and one electronic part, an electrolytic capacitor. They do go bad, but are easily replaceable and are cheap.

First, I'd make sure the motor was actually bad and not just a failed $20 starting capacitor. If it hums and you can spin the blades to get it running, it's a bad cap.

If the motor is bad, I think I would probably gamble the $500 for a replacement and install it myself.
 
I use to keep a used spare condenser fan motor, but threw it out. Highly typical to lose the capacitor. Stupid HVAC techs upsell. However, it could be a failed motor, or not. If there is no cartel in your state, go the an HVAC supply or online and buy a generic fan motor to match. Rarely, they have 2 speed motors, but with your SEER rating, likely only a single speed, pretty easy to tell by wiring. Highly unlikely that it should cost $500. FGS, its just a simple fan motor. Go to Grainger on line and get a replacement. American Standard should be an easy cross reference for a matching Baldor or Reliance motor, but check the capacitor first. Also try Supplyhouse.com.
